AI 대화만으로 웹 서비스를 완성하는 생산성 중심의 개발 가이드

시니어 개발자 김도현이 전하는 AI 기반 웹 개발 팁. Cursor IDE, Next.js, Vercel을 활용한 생산성 향상 노하우와 솔직한 강의 후기를 확인하세요.

이재호13 min read

<article>

백엔드 개발자로 6년 동안 근무하며 수많은 생산성 향상 도구를 접했지만, 최근의 생성형 AI 코딩 흐름은 그 궤를 달리한다. 이제 개발은 '어떻게 타이핑하는가'가 아니라 '어떻게 지시하고 검증하는가'의 영역으로 넘어갔다. Cursor IDE와 같은 도구를 활용하면 프론트엔드 상태 관리부터 복잡한 API 설계 및 구현까지의 시간을 70% 이상 단축할 수 있다. 시니어 개발자 입장에서 유료 강좌 ROI 분석을 해본 결과, 단순한 코드 복사 수준을 넘어 아키텍처를 설계하는 안목을 기르는 데 AI가 강력한 조력자가 됨을 확인했다.

생성형 AI 코딩 시대의 개발 패러다임 변화

생성형 AI 코딩은 개발자가 반복적인 보일러플레이트 코드 작성에서 벗어나 비즈니스 로직과 시스템 설계에 집중하게 만든다. 프롬프트 엔지니어링을 통해 의도를 정확히 전달하면, AI는 수 초 내에 작동 가능한 초안을 제시한다.

과거에는 Stack Overflow를 뒤지며 시간을 보냈다면, 이제는 GitHub Copilot이나 Cursor 내의 LLM에게 직접 질문하며 해결책을 찾는다. 하지만 AI가 내놓는 결과물이 항상 클린 코드 원칙을 준수하는 것은 아니다. 기술 부채 관리를 위해서는 생성된 코드를 비판적으로 바라보고 코드 리팩토링을 수행하는 능력이 더욱 중요해졌다. 특히 LLM 파인튜닝이 된 모델들은 최신 라이브러리 문법을 정확히 반영하지 못할 때가 있어, 공식 문서와의 교차 검증은 여전히 필수적이다.

"3개월 만에 3개의 서비스를 AI 대화로 제작했다." — 강의 상세 설명 중

Next.js와 Cursor IDE를 활용한 풀스택 웹 개발 실전

Next.js 프레임워크와 Cursor IDE의 조합은 풀스택 웹 개발의 진입 장벽을 획기적으로 낮춘다. 대화형 인터페이스를 통해 복잡한 폴더 구조를 자동으로 생성하고, 서버 사이드 렌더링(SSR) 로직을 손쉽게 구현할 수 있다.

React 컴포넌트 구조와 Tailwind CSS의 조화

Tailwind CSS는 AI가 스타일링을 추론하기 가장 좋은 유틸리티 우선 프레임워크다. React 컴포넌트 구조 안에서 클래스 이름을 직접 지정하기 때문에 AI가 의도를 명확히 파악하여 디자인을 생성한다.

실제로 작업을 해보면 AI가 컴포넌트 분리 기준을 모호하게 잡는 경우가 있다. 이때는 "Atomic Design 패턴에 맞춰 컴포넌트를 분리해줘"와 같이 구체적인 프롬프트를 주는 것이 좋다. TypeScript 정적 타이핑을 적용하면 AI가 타입을 추론하는 과정에서 발생할 수 있는 런타임 에러를 빌드 타임에 미리 잡아낼 수 있어 안정성이 높아진다.

// Cursor IDE에서 생성한 Next.js API Route 예시
import { NextRequest, NextResponse } from 'next/server';

export async function POST(req: NextRequest) {
  const data = await req.json();
  // AI 기반 코드 리뷰를 통해 보안 취약점 점검 필요
  if (!data.title) {
    return NextResponse.json({ error: 'Title is required' }, { status: 400 });
  }

  return NextResponse.json({ message: 'Success', id: Date.now() });
}

백엔드 아키텍처와 데이터베이스 스키마 설계

커서 에이아이를 활용한 생산성 중심의 웹 개발 입문 가이드

효율적인 백엔드 아키텍처 구축을 위해 AI는 데이터베이스 스키마 설계 단계를 비약적으로 단축시킨다. 엔티티 간의 관계를 설명하면 AI가 Prisma나 Drizzle ORM에 맞는 스키마 코드를 즉시 생성한다.

Serverless Functions를 활용한 확장성 있는 서버 구조 설계도 AI의 도움을 받으면 수월하다. 다만, 복잡한 트랜잭션 처리나 동시성 제어 부분에서는 AI가 논리적 오류를 범할 수 있다. 시니어 경험한 바로는, AI가 짠 쿼리를 그대로 쓰기보다는 실행 계획을 확인하는 습관이 중요하다. 데이터베이스 인덱싱 전략 같은 세밀한 최적화는 여전히 인간의 영역에 머물러 있다.

강의 구성 요소상세 사양
핵심 기술 스택Next.js, Tailwind CSS, TypeScript
주요 도구Cursor IDE, Vercel, Supabase
학습 방식AI 대화 기반의 실무 프로젝트 가이드
프로젝트 개수3개 이상의 실전 웹 서비스
수강 기간6개월 무제한 (복습 가능)
난이도초급~중급 (개발 입문자 포함)

실전 프로젝트 배포 및 디버깅 자동화 전략

Vercel 배포를 활용하면 로컬에서 개발한 서비스를 단 몇 분 만에 전 세계에 공개할 수 있다. CI/CD 파이프라인이 자동으로 구축되어 코드 수정 사항이 실시간으로 반영된다.

개발 과정에서 발생하는 에러는 디버깅 자동화 기능을 통해 해결한다. Cursor의 'Fix with AI' 기능을 사용하면 에러 로그를 분석해 즉각적인 수정 제안을 받을 수 있다. 하지만 주의할 점이 있다. AI는 때로 에러의 근본 원인을 고치기보다 증상만 가리는 임시방편(Monkey Patch)을 제시하기도 한다. 에이크(Ake) 강의 후기들을 살펴보면 이러한 AI의 한계를 인지하고 인간이 최종 검수를 하는 과정의 중요성을 공통적으로 강조하고 있다.

효율적인 학습을 위한 혜택 체크리스트

  • 6개월 무제한 수강권으로 충분한 복습 시간 확보
  • 실무 프로젝트 파일 및 소스 코드 제공으로 즉시 활용 가능
  • 모바일 수강 지원으로 출퇴근 시간 활용 극대화
  • 20년 경력 기획자의 AI 활용 노하우 전수로 비즈니스 관점 습득

종합적으로 볼 때, AI 기반 코딩 교육은 단순한 지식 전달을 넘어 실질적인 생산성 도구 활용 능력을 키워준다. 6년 차 느낀 단점은 AI에 너무 의존할 경우 기초적인 알고리즘이나 언어의 동작 원리를 망각할 수 있다는 점이다. 이를 방지하기 위해 일주일에 하루 정도는 AI 없이 코딩하거나, AI가 짠 코드를 한 줄씩 뜯어보는 분석 시간이 반드시 병행되어야 한다. 이러한 균형만 잡는다면 AI는 당신의 개발 인생에서 가장 강력한 듀오가 될 것이다.

관련 강의

[프리미엄] AI와 대화하며 웹 서비스 만들기 강의 | 에이크 — 인프런 [프리미엄] AI와 대화하며 웹 서비스 만들기 강의 | 에이크 — 인프런 자주 묻는 질문 대화형 인터페이스로 코딩 생산성을 높이는 핵심 강좌다.

[프리미엄] AI와 대화하며 웹 서비스 만들기 강의 | 에이크 효과 있어?

AI를 활용해 개발 생산성을 70% 이상 높이는 실무 중심 강의입니다. 단순 코드 복사를 넘어 Cursor IDE와 프롬프트 엔지니어링으로 아키텍처 설계와 로직 구현 속도를 획기적으로 단축하는 효과를 경험할 수 있습니다.

[프리미엄] AI와 대화하며 웹 서비스 만들기 강의 | 에이크 vs 일반 강의 차이는?

일반 강의가 문법 위주라면, 에이크 강의는 생성형 AI를 동료 개발자처럼 활용하는 법을 다룹니다. Next.js와 Tailwind CSS 환경에서 AI로 기술 부채를 관리하며 서비스를 완성하는 최신 개발 패러다임을 배웁니다.

[프리미엄] AI와 대화하며 웹 서비스 만들기 강의 | 에이크 사용법 및 준비물?

Cursor IDE와 GitHub Copilot 등 최신 AI 도구 설정부터 시작합니다. 프롬프트로 의도를 전달하고, AI가 생성한 코드를 Next.js 기반에서 비판적으로 검증 및 리팩토링하는 전체 실무 프로세스를 학습하게 됩니다.

[프리미엄] AI와 대화하며 웹 서비스 만들기 강의 | 에이크 단점은?

AI 모델이 최신 라이브러리 문법을 완벽히 반영하지 못할 때가 있습니다. 이를 해결하기 위해 공식 문서와 교차 검증하는 과정이 필수적이며, AI에 전적으로 의존하기보다 코드 리뷰 능력을 기르는 데 집중해야 합니다.

[프리미엄] AI와 대화하며 웹 서비스 만들기 강의 | 에이크 비용 아깝지 않을까?

시니어 개발자의 생산성 노하우를 단시간에 습득할 수 있어 ROI가 매우 높습니다. 수개월이 걸릴 개발 과정을 며칠로 단축하는 실전 기술을 전수하므로, 개발 시간 절약과 커리어 성장을 고려하면 충분한 가치가 있습니다.

출처

  1. 인프런 - AI와 대화하며 웹 서비스 만들기 강의 상세 페이지
👨‍💻

이재호

6년차 시니어 개발자. Python과 JavaScript 전문. 실무에서 검증된 개발 노하우 공유.